Abstract
This invention provides a method for a subscriber television system client device to provide a three-dimensional user interface comprising a virtual reality media space. The three-dimensional user interface allows the user to navigate a three dimensional environment, participate in activities, and interact with other users. The three-dimensional user interface enables the user to associate personal characteristics with an avatar which represents the user in the system, such personal characteristics comprising a symbol, a picture, and video.

2. A method in a Subscriber Television System (STS) client device of providing a user interface, the method comprising the steps of:
-
implementing the user interface to be a three-dimensional (3D) user interface;
displaying in the 3D user interface a Virtual Reality (VR) world having a 3D landscape and a Virtual Reality (VR) media space to a first user;
navigating through the VR world to access services offered through a Subscriber Television System (STS), wherein the STS client device is coupled to the STS;
displaying in the 3D user interface an avatar of a second user to the first user; and
enabling the first user to maneuver through the VR World by selectively jumping to predetermined positions in the VR World, wherein responsive to the first user jumping from a first position in the VR World to a second position in the VR World, the avatar of the second user jumps to the second position. - View Dependent Claims (3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24, 25)

26. A method in a Subscriber Television System (STS) client device of providing a user interface, the method comprising the steps of:
-
implementing the user interface to be a three-dimensional (3D) user interface;
displaying in the 3D user interface a Virtual Reality (VR) world having a 3D landscape and a Virtual Reality (VR) media space to a first user;
navigating through the VR world to access services offered through a Subscriber Television System (STS), wherein the STS client device is coupled to the STS;
displaying in the 3D user interface at least a portion of a dashboard of a transportation device belonging to an avatar of the user, wherein the dashboard includes a map of the VR World and jump selection control panel, and wherein the map shows the current position of the avatar in the VR World; and
selecting from the jump selection control panel a predetermined destination in the VR World, wherein responsive to the user selecting the predetermined destination the map reflects the new position of the avatar in the VR World.
